Kinds Of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:

Professional installers are competent in dealing with a variety of cat door types and installation areas. This flexibility is another essential advantage of working with an expert.

Here are some common kinds of cat doors and places installers can deal with:

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are easy, cost-efficient doors with a flexible flap that the cat pushes through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ors require the cat to wear a magnetic collar, avoiding undesirable animals from going into.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most safe and secure and advanced alternatives, reading your cat's microchip to allow entry just to your pet, keeping out roaming animals and keeping home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ors use a tunnel extension to bridge the space.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ation location.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into various kinds of wood doors, consisting of strong core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ass needs specialized skills and tools. Professionals can securely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, ensuring structural integrity and a tidy finish.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, frequently leading to basements or garages. This needs knowledge in wall building and framing.Patio Area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io area doors or moving glass doors, frequently by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, enabling ventilation while supplying p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:

The cost of professional cat door installation can vary depending upon a number of aspects:
Type of Cat Door: More advanced doors like microchip designs may have a slightly higher installation cost due to their complexity.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is typically more intricate and might cost more than setting up in a standard wood door.Intricacy of the Job: If adjustments to the door frame or surrounding structure are required, this can increase the general c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ending upon their experience, location, and local market value.
It's constantly best to get a comprehensive quote from the installer before continuing, describing all expenses included.
